Fix Rss Feeds プラグインを使用して WordPress フィード表示エラーを修正する
今日、あるネチズンが突然、ブログのフィードがダウンしたというメッセージを残しました。症状は次のとおりです。
Chrome で直接購読ページを開くと、次のように表示されます。
This page contains the following errors: error on line 1 at column 1: Document is empty Below is a rendering of the page up to the first error.
FeedDemon ヒント: このフィードには次の内容が含まれています。エラー。
追加後の影響はなく、正常に使用できます。
Xianguo Readerでも読むことができますが、最新の記事はご覧いただけません。
IEで試してみたところ、「ドキュメントの最上位に無効なコンテンツが存在します。」と表示されました
ソースコードを見ると、HTML形式を解析するとコンテンツが表示されることが分かりました。 WordPress のフィード出力には問題ありません。問題は特定のファイル形式にあります。しかし、どのファイルに問題があるのかを見つけるのはさらに困難です。インターネット上で紹介されている解決策はおおよそ次のとおりです。
上下に余分な復帰と改行がないか確認する
1. wp-config.php ファイルを確認し、コード内に復帰があるかどうかを確認するPHP 本文の外側のシンボル;
2. 上記と同様に、wp-rss2.php および wp-atom.php ファイルを検出します。 、functions.php ファイルを検出します。
4. フィードがキャッシュされていることに注意してください。それでもエラーが発生する場合は、すべてのプラグインを一時的に閉じたり、テーマを変更したりして、プラグインを 1 つずつ削除してみてください。
上記のファイルをすべて変更しましたが、まだ手がかりがありません。 。そこで「Fix Rss Feed」というプラグインをインストールして有効にして修正しました。そして修復後、プラグインを削除してもリバウンドは発生しません~
このプラグインを調査したところ、WordPress ルートディレクトリにある wp-blog-header.php を変更しただけのようです。このファイルを次のように変更します:
<?php /** * Loads the WordPress environment and template. * * @package WordPress */ if ( !isset($wp_did_header) ) { $wp_did_header = true; ob_start(); //2010-09-18 gofunnow.com added, it will Fix rss feed error "Error on line 2: The processing instruction target matching "[xX][mM][lL]" is not allowed." while burn feed from feedburner.com <strong>require</strong>_once( dirname(__FILE__) . '/wp-load.php' ); ob_end_clean(); //2010-09-18 gofunnow.com added, it will Fix rss feed error "Error on line 2: The processing instruction target matching "[xX][mM][lL]" is not allowed." while burn feed from feedburner.com wp(); <strong>require</strong>_once( ABSPATH . WPINC . '/template-loader.php' ); } ?>
それだけです。
上記では、Fix Rss Feed プラグインを使用して WordPress フィードの表示エラーを修正する方法を、必要なコンテンツを含めて紹介しました。PHP チュートリアルに興味のある友人に役立つことを願っています。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ック











WordPressの記事リストを調整するには4つの方法があります。テーマオプションを使用し、プラグイン(投稿タイプの注文、WP投稿リスト、ボックスのものなど)を使用し、コード(functions.phpファイルに設定を追加)を使用するか、WordPressデータベースを直接変更します。

WordPressホストを使用してWebサイトを構築するには、次のようにする必要があります。信頼できるホスティングプロバイダーを選択します。ドメイン名を購入します。 WordPressホスティングアカウントを設定します。トピックを選択します。ページと記事を追加します。プラグインをインストールします。ウェブサイトをカスタマイズします。あなたのウェブサイトを公開します。

IISとPHPは互換性があり、FastCGIを通じて実装されています。 1..phpファイル要求を構成ファイルを介してFastCGIモジュールに転送します。 2. FASTCGIモジュールは、PHPプロセスを開始して、パフォーマンスと安定性を改善するための要求を処理します。 3。実際のアプリケーションでは、構成の詳細、エラーデバッグ、パフォーマンスの最適化に注意する必要があります。

WordPressのヘッダー画像を置き換えるための段階的なガイド:WordPressダッシュボードにログインし、外観とGT;テーマに移動します。編集するトピックを選択し、[カスタマイズ]をクリックします。テーマオプションパネルを開き、サイトヘッダーまたはヘッダーの画像オプションを探します。 [画像の選択]ボタンをクリックして、新しいヘッド画像をアップロードします。画像をトリミングして、保存と収穫をクリックします。 [保存と公開]ボタンをクリックして、変更を更新します。

WordPressの編集日は、次の3つの方法でキャンセルできます。 2. functions.phpファイルにコードを追加します。 3. wp_postsテーブルのpost_modified列を手動で編集します。

WordPressでカスタムヘッダーを作成する手順は次のとおりです。テーマファイル「header.php」を編集します。あなたのウェブサイトの名前と説明を追加します。ナビゲーションメニューを作成します。検索バーを追加します。変更を保存して、カスタムヘッダーを表示します。

WordPressソースコードのインポートには、次の手順が必要です。テーマ変更のサブテーマを作成します。ソースコードをインポートし、サブトピックのファイルを上書きします。サブテーマを有効にして効果的にします。変更をテストして、すべてが機能することを確認します。

ダッシュボードにログインし、[サイト]タブに切り替えることにより、WordPressのフロントエンドを表示できます。ヘッドレスブラウザで視聴プロセスを自動化します。 WordPressプラグインをインストールして、ダッシュボード内のフロントエンドをプレビューします。ローカルURLを介してフロントエンドを表示します(WordPressがローカルに設定されている場合)。
